Figure 1. STD-LTD requires the activation of CB1 receptors.

Figure 1

(A) Schematic representation of the experimental design. (B) The stimulation of granule cells in the dentate gyrus followed the postsynaptic spike by 50 ms. (C) MF-GPSCs evoked before, after pairing, after addition of L-AP4 or L-AP4 plus picrotoxin (PTX), in the absence (Control) or in the presence of AM251 (each trace is the average of 30–60 trials including failures). (D) Mean GPSCs amplitude (before and after pairing, arrows at time 0) is plotted against time. Open circles: control (n = 44); closed circles: in the presence of AM251(n = 12); vertical bars are SEM. (E) Paired-pulse ratio measured before (Control) and after pairing in neurons exhibiting LTD (grey STD-D; n = 12). ***p<0.001. (F) Plot of 1/CV2 versus GPSCs amplitude measured after LTD induction and normalized to respective controls. The closed circle indicate the mean (SEM is within the symbols).
